Foundation repairs require specialized skills and equipment. Professional contractors, including foundation repair specialists, structural engineers, and general contractors, are the primary providers of these services. They ensure that foundation issues are diagnosed accurately and repaired effectively, restoring stability to your home or building.
These experts focus exclusively on foundation issues, offering services such as piering, underpinning, and crack repair. They have extensive experience and use advanced techniques to stabilize and repair foundations.
Structural engineers assess foundation problems and design repair solutions. They often collaborate with contractors to ensure repairs meet safety and durability standards.
General contractors coordinate foundation repair projects along with other home improvement tasks. They manage the scheduling, labor, and materials needed for comprehensive repairs.

When hiring a professional for foundation repairs, expect a thorough inspection, clear communication of repair options, and a detailed estimate. Reputable contractors will explain the scope of work, timeline, and costs upfront. Ensure they are licensed and insured to protect yourself from liability.

The best time to hire someone for foundation repairs is as soon as you notice signs of trouble, such as cracks or uneven floors. Early intervention can prevent more extensive and costly damage. Typically, the ideal seasons are spring and fall when weather conditions are mild, allowing for efficient repairs without delays caused by extreme heat or cold.
